A well-structured SME chart of accounts
A good chart of accounts tells the story of the business: classes 1 and 2 describe what it owns and owes, class 3 what it sells, classes 4 to 6 what it consumes. Private accounts (sole proprietorships) and shareholder current accounts (Sàrl/SA) must stay spotless: they are the first thing examined in a tax audit.
In an SME in Montagny-près-Yverdon, the chart of accounts is also a delegation tool: clear posting rules let a non-accountant prepare most entries without error.

Frequently asked questions
Which documents should be prepared for the year-end closing?
Bank and cash statements at the closing date, the inventory of stock and work in progress, final AHV/LPP/accident settlements, contracts signed or amended during the year, invoices straddling two years and the detail of accruals. With an up-to-date document archive, most of it is already there. The list is identical in Montagny-près-Yverdon: the CO dictates it, not the commune.

What is simplified bookkeeping and who can use it?
Sole proprietorships and partnerships under CHF 500,000 of revenue may limit themselves to recording income, expenses and assets (art. 957 para. 2 CO). Once over the threshold — or upon founding a Sàrl or an SA — full accounts with balance sheet, income statement and notes become mandatory. When must a business register for VAT?
As soon as its worldwide annual turnover reaches CHF 100,000 (CHF 250,000 for non-profit sports or cultural associations). Below that, voluntary registration remains possible and often makes sense to reclaim input VAT on investments.
